Z34 - Encounter for supervision of normal pregnancy

Encounter for supervision of normal pregnancy (Z34) focuses on healthcare services related to reproductive health, pregnancy care, delivery, and postpartum management. These codes capture essential encounters for family planning, prenatal monitoring, childbirth outcomes, infant categorization at birth, and maternal follow-up after delivery.

Diagnosis

Diagnosis is clinical and administrative, often involving pregnancy tests, ultrasound assessments, antenatal screening (e.g., bloodwork, genetic testing), contraceptive device evaluations, delivery documentation, and postpartum examinations. Accurate dating (Z3A) is vital for appropriate prenatal and obstetric care planning.

ICD10 Code Usage

The ICD10 code Z34 is used in obstetric records, family planning centers, maternal health monitoring systems, birth registries, insurance billing, and public health surveillance. Accurate coding supports safe maternity care, fertility services, newborn classification, and postpartum health tracking.

Q3: What is tracked during antenatal screenings?
A: Screenings check for chromosomal conditions, fetal anomalies, maternal infections, and overall pregnancy health status.

Q4: How does Z3A help in pregnancy management?
A: Z3A codes specify gestational age, crucial for timing diagnostic tests, assessing fetal development, and planning delivery strategies.

Q5: What types of contraceptive management are covered under Z30?
A: It includes counseling, insertion, surveillance, and removal of contraceptive devices like IUDs, implants, and sterilization discussions.
